Zamacore Blog

Software Development Company in Kenya

May 21, 2026 12 min read Uncategorized

Software Development Company in Kenya

Software Development Company in Kenya is an important search for businesses that want reliable digital systems, modern websites, mobile apps, SaaS platforms, and ICT solutions that can support real growth. ZamaCore helps companies, schools, hospitals, SMEs, startups, and organizations in Kenya move from manual processes to secure, scalable, and easy-to-use technology.

In a competitive business environment, the right software can reduce repetitive work, improve reporting, strengthen customer service, and give management better control over daily operations. ZamaCore builds practical digital solutions for Kenyan businesses that need technology designed around their workflows, not generic tools that force the business to adjust.

If your organization needs a dependable partner for custom software, website development, mobile app development, business systems, SaaS products, or ICT consulting, ZamaCore is ready to help you plan, build, launch, and improve the right solution.

Software Development Company in Kenya - ZamaCore

Table of Contents

Why Choose ZamaCore as Your Software Development Company in Kenya?

Choosing a Software Development Company in Kenya is not only about finding someone who can write code. It is about choosing a technology partner who understands business operations, user experience, security, scalability, and the Kenyan market. ZamaCore focuses on building systems that solve practical problems and create measurable value.

Many businesses start with simple tools such as spreadsheets, paper records, WhatsApp conversations, and manual approvals. These methods can work in the early stages, but they often become difficult to manage as operations grow. Files get duplicated, reports take too long, customer details become scattered, and managers struggle to see what is happening in real time.

ZamaCore helps businesses replace fragmented processes with organized digital platforms. Whether you need a customer portal, internal management system, booking platform, school management system, hospital system, real estate system, ERP, CRM, or custom dashboard, the goal is the same: make your operations easier to control, easier to measure, and easier to scale.

Our work is guided by clear communication, clean design, dependable engineering, and a strong focus on business outcomes. We do not build technology for the sake of technology. We build systems that help teams save time, serve customers better, improve accountability, and support long-term growth.

Software Development Services Offered by ZamaCore

ZamaCore provides a wide range of digital services for organizations that need dependable technology in Kenya. Every project is planned around the client's objectives, budget, users, and growth strategy.

Custom Software Development

Custom software development is ideal when off-the-shelf tools cannot fully support your business model. ZamaCore designs and develops tailored systems for operations, reporting, customer management, payments, staff workflows, inventory, bookings, records, approvals, and industry-specific needs.

A custom system gives your business more control because it can be built around the way your organization actually works. You can start with essential features and expand over time as your needs grow.

Website Design and Development

Your website is often the first serious point of contact between your business and potential customers. ZamaCore builds professional websites that are fast, mobile-responsive, search-friendly, and designed to convert visitors into leads.

We develop business websites, corporate websites, service pages, landing pages, e-commerce websites, booking websites, school websites, hospital websites, and custom web portals. A good website should not only look polished. It should explain your offer clearly, build trust, and make it easy for visitors to take action.

Mobile App Development

Mobile apps help businesses reach users directly on the devices they use every day. ZamaCore develops mobile app solutions for customer engagement, service booking, learning, healthcare, field operations, delivery workflows, property management, reporting, and other business needs.

We focus on clean navigation, useful features, and stable performance so that users can complete tasks without confusion. The best app is one that people actually use because it makes their work or life easier.

SaaS Platform Development

For entrepreneurs and companies building subscription-based digital products, ZamaCore can help design and develop SaaS platforms. This may include account management, payment integration, subscription plans, dashboards, role permissions, reporting, customer onboarding, and administrative controls.

SaaS development requires careful thinking about scalability, security, billing, support, and product improvement. ZamaCore helps you move from idea to usable platform with a clear roadmap.

ICT Solutions and Consulting

ZamaCore also supports businesses with ICT solutions that improve digital operations. This may include system planning, automation advice, cloud setup, data management, digital transformation consulting, and support for organizations moving away from manual workflows.

Custom Business Systems for Kenyan Organizations

One of the strongest reasons to work with a professional software development company is the ability to build systems that match your organization's daily reality. Kenyan businesses are diverse. A school, clinic, logistics company, real estate agency, SACCO, consultancy, and retail business all manage different types of information and workflows.

ZamaCore develops business systems that can include dashboards, user roles, client records, payment tracking, invoices, receipts, inventory, admissions, patient records, property listings, reports, notifications, staff management, audit trails, and approval workflows.

Instead of forcing your team to manage everything manually, a custom system gives each person the right tools for their role. Management can see reports. Staff can update records. Customers can submit requests. Administrators can manage users and settings. This creates a more organized and accountable business environment.

ERP and CRM Systems

Enterprise resource planning and customer relationship management systems help companies organize internal operations and customer interactions. ZamaCore can build ERP and CRM solutions for Kenyan businesses that need better control of sales, leads, staff activities, customer communication, projects, invoices, stock, and performance reports.

A well-built CRM helps your team follow up with leads, understand customer history, and reduce missed opportunities. A well-built ERP brings core business processes into one structured platform.

School Management Systems

Schools need reliable tools for admissions, student records, fee tracking, class management, exams, reports, parent communication, staff management, and finance. ZamaCore can create school management systems that help administrators reduce paperwork and improve efficiency.

For learning institutions, the benefit is not just digitization. It is better visibility, faster reporting, improved communication, and stronger control over school operations.

Hospital and Clinic Management Systems

Healthcare facilities need accurate records and smooth workflows. ZamaCore can develop hospital and clinic management systems for patient registration, appointments, billing, pharmacy, laboratory records, consultation notes, reports, and administrative management.

A digital healthcare system can reduce delays, improve patient service, and help management access important information when needed.

Property Management Systems

Real estate businesses, landlords, and property managers need tools for tenants, leases, invoices, rent payments, maintenance requests, property listings, and reports. ZamaCore builds property management systems that make it easier to manage units, payments, and communication from one place.

Industries ZamaCore Serves in Kenya

ZamaCore works with organizations across different sectors because most modern businesses need some form of digital system. Our solutions can support SMEs, schools, hospitals, real estate companies, consultants, professional service firms, logistics providers, non-profits, e-commerce businesses, and startups.

For SMEs, we focus on affordability, clarity, and scalability. A growing business should not have to invest in an oversized system from day one. It can begin with the features that matter most and expand as revenue, users, and operations grow.

For established organizations, we focus on process improvement, security, reporting, integrations, and maintainability. Larger teams need software that supports multiple roles, reduces operational friction, and provides reliable data for decision-making.

For startups, speed and flexibility are important. ZamaCore can help shape an idea into a minimum viable product, test core assumptions, and improve the platform based on real user feedback.

Our Software Development Process

A successful software project needs more than development work. It needs discovery, planning, design, implementation, testing, launch, and continuous improvement. ZamaCore follows a structured process so clients understand what is being built and why.

1. Discovery and Requirements

We begin by understanding your business goals, current challenges, users, workflows, and expected outcomes. This stage helps define the right features and avoid unnecessary complexity.

2. Solution Planning

After discovery, we outline the system structure, core modules, user roles, integrations, data flow, and development priorities. Clear planning keeps the project focused and makes it easier to estimate timelines and costs.

3. Design and User Experience

Good software should be easy to use. ZamaCore designs interfaces that help users complete tasks quickly and confidently. We focus on clean layouts, readable information, simple navigation, and practical workflows.

4. Development

During development, the planned system is built using suitable technologies and clean coding practices. The goal is to create a stable platform that can support real business use.

5. Testing and Quality Assurance

Before launch, the system is tested for functionality, usability, performance, and common errors. Testing helps identify issues early and improves the final user experience.

6. Launch and Support

Once the system is ready, ZamaCore helps with deployment and launch support. After launch, improvements can be made based on user feedback, business changes, and new opportunities.

Benefits of Custom Software for Your Business

Custom software gives your business the flexibility to operate in a way that matches your goals. Unlike generic tools, a tailored system can be designed for your specific processes, users, reports, and customer experience.

Better efficiency: A digital system can automate repetitive tasks, reduce paperwork, and help staff complete work faster.

Improved reporting: Management can access structured reports instead of waiting for manual summaries or scattered spreadsheets.

Stronger customer service: Customer records, requests, payments, and communication can be organized in one platform.

Reduced errors: Digital workflows help reduce duplication, missing records, and manual calculation mistakes.

Scalable growth: Your system can evolve as your business grows, adds branches, expands services, or reaches more customers.

Competitive advantage: Businesses that use technology well can respond faster, serve customers better, and make decisions based on real data.

Software Development Company in Kenya for SMEs and Growing Businesses

SMEs need technology that is powerful enough to solve real problems but practical enough to fit their stage of growth. ZamaCore understands that many businesses want a clear return on investment. That is why we focus on features that support revenue, efficiency, accountability, and customer satisfaction.

For example, a service business may need a booking system, customer database, invoice management, and automated notifications. A school may need fee tracking and student reports. A clinic may need patient records and billing. A real estate business may need tenant management and rent reports. Each solution should be shaped by the business model.

Working with ZamaCore gives you a partner who can translate your operational needs into a practical digital system. The result is software that supports your team instead of overwhelming them.

How to Choose the Right Software Development Partner in Kenya

When selecting a technology partner, look beyond price alone. The cheapest option can become expensive if the project is poorly planned, difficult to use, insecure, or impossible to maintain. A reliable partner should understand your objectives, communicate clearly, and build with long-term value in mind.

Here are important questions to ask before starting a project:

  • Does the company understand your business problem?
  • Can they explain the recommended solution clearly?
  • Will the system be easy for your team to use?
  • Can the software grow with your business?
  • How will security, backups, and user access be handled?
  • What support is available after launch?

ZamaCore approaches every project with these questions in mind. The aim is to help you make a confident investment in technology that supports your organization for years.

Long-Term Support, Security, and Improvement

Launching a system is an important milestone, but it is not the end of the journey. Business requirements change, users request improvements, security needs evolve, and new opportunities appear after a system is used in real operations. ZamaCore encourages clients to think about software as a long-term business asset that should be maintained and improved over time.

Good support helps your team stay productive after launch. This can include fixing issues, improving reports, adding features, training users, checking performance, and making sure the platform continues to support your workflow. For growing businesses, this matters because a system that worked for five users may need additional roles, branches, permissions, or integrations when the company expands.

Security is also a key part of professional software development. User access, strong passwords, data protection, backups, hosting choices, and careful handling of customer information should be considered from the beginning. Kenyan organizations that collect personal information should also pay attention to responsible data management and privacy requirements.

ZamaCore builds with maintainability in mind so that your digital platform can continue to create value after the first version goes live. The goal is to give your business a reliable foundation, then keep improving it as your needs become clearer and your operations grow.

For stronger SEO and user navigation, add relevant internal links from this article to key ZamaCore service pages when they are available.

Internal Link Suggestions

External Authority Link Suggestions

Frequently Asked Questions

What does a software development company in Kenya do?

A software development company in Kenya designs, builds, tests, and supports digital systems such as websites, mobile apps, business management platforms, SaaS products, ERP systems, CRM systems, and custom software for organizations.

Why should I choose ZamaCore for software development?

ZamaCore focuses on practical, scalable, and professional digital solutions for Kenyan businesses. The company builds custom software, websites, mobile apps, SaaS platforms, and ICT solutions that help organizations improve operations and serve customers better.

Can ZamaCore build custom business software?

Yes. ZamaCore can build custom business software for customer management, payments, reporting, staff workflows, inventory, bookings, approvals, school operations, healthcare records, property management, and other business needs.

Does ZamaCore develop websites and mobile apps?

Yes. ZamaCore develops professional websites and mobile apps for businesses, schools, hospitals, SMEs, startups, and organizations that need reliable digital platforms.

How much does Custom Software Development cost in Kenya?

The cost depends on the project size, features, design requirements, integrations, user roles, and support needs. ZamaCore can review your requirements and recommend a suitable development approach based on your goals and budget.

Can my software be expanded later?

Yes. A well-planned custom system can start with core features and expand over time. ZamaCore can help you add new modules, users, reports, integrations, and improvements as your business grows.

Talk to ZamaCore

If you are searching for a dependable Software Development Company in Kenya, ZamaCore can help you turn your idea, workflow, or business challenge into a professional digital solution. Whether you need custom software, a website, a mobile app, a SaaS platform, or a complete business management system, our team is ready to guide you from planning to launch.

Contact ZamaCore today to discuss your project and build a digital solution that helps your business operate better, grow faster, and serve customers with confidence.

Leave a Reply

Your email address will not be published. Required fields are marked *